MOVIE NEWS

Down to Last SIOO. He Won $150,000 “llaintrec County”" a first novel by Ross- Lockriclge has won the semi-annual Ml-G-Mv JSpvel- Award. According to the 33-year-old author himself, his peronal fypds amounted to exactly SIOO when lie learned that his work had been accepted for production *by the M.G.M. Studios.' Six j years went into the writing and re-writing 1 of “Raintree : County” which * the judges consider-to be' one bffthe most remarkable 'fnovehs. ever submitted, For the .first time since the ‘inception of tire' M.G.M. Novel Award, another ‘Vliovel, “About Lyddy Thonj.as” by Maritta M. Wolff, has also .beep selected for a special awaref for exceptional merit and the scre’Cn- rights acquired. Miss Wolff is the. author of “Whistle Stop” -arid' “Night Shift” both .of which liave bee'n made into pictures.
